“Yes,” said the shoemakers. “We will have it done by half-past two.”
Then the shoemakers worked and sang:
“Rap-a-tap, tap! Tick-a-tack, too!
This must be done by half-past two.”
Soon Bobby came back and said, “It is half-past two. Is my shoe mended?”
“I have passed it to my next-door neighbor,” answered the head shoemaker.
“Is my shoe mended?” asked Bobby of the next-door neighbor.
“My next-door neighbor has it,” was the answer.
